This Extended Three bedroomed Terraced Property situated in the highly popular residential area of Dentons Green, close to good Schools, the A580, motorway network, local shops and within walking distance of St Helens Town Centre. The property, which is warmed by gas central heating (new boiler 2008), loft insulation and UPVC double glazing briefly comprises;- Through Lounge/Dining Room, Kitchen, Bathroom

(refitted 2007) to the first floor there are 3 good sized Bedrooms with plans in place for the addition of an upstairs w.c.,. To the front of the property is a walled paved garden with street lined parking, to the rear, a remote controlled electric gate onto driveway providing off road parking for one car, the garden is also paved with established borders of shrubs, hedges and seasonal planting. The property, which has been recently refurbished by its present owners has new decor and carpets to the first floor. VIEWING IS HIGHLY RECOMMENDED

THROUGH LOUNGE 3.41m(11'2'') x 4.37m(14'4'') A bright and airy room with feature wooden fireplace with tiled back and hearth housing a fitted gas fire, central heating radiator, two meter cupboards, the room has windows to both ends providing all day sunshine, open plan to ;- DINING AREA 2.75m(9'0'') x 3.53m(11'7'') With a double glazed window with views to the rear of the property, central heating radiator, walk-in understairs storage cupboard. KITCHEN 3.55m(11'8'') x 2.33m(7'8'') Light and airy kitchen with large double glazed window to the side of the property, white wall and base units with worktops to accord, single drainer sink unit, plumbed for automatic washing machine, new part tiled walls and ceramic tiled floor, the central heating boiler(new 2008) is housed here inside a cupboard to accord. ALTERNATIVE KITCHEN VIEW
ANTI-SPACE With wood tongue and groove ceiling, storage cupboard, ceramic tiled floor, half glazed rear door to outside. BATHROOM 1.85m(6'1'') x 2.04m(6'8'') A modern bright room with a contemporary feel comprising: three piece white bathroom suite (newly fitted 2007) comprising of panelled bath with electric trition shower over, pedestal washbasin, low W.C., chrome fittings to accord, part tiled walls, wood tongue and groove ceiling, ceramic tiled floor, obscure double glazed window. LANDING 3.52m(11'7'') x 1.74m(5'9'') Bright landing with carpeted floor and loft access. BEDROOM ONE 2.77m(9'1'') x 4.36m(14'4'') With double glazed window to the front of the property, central heating radiator, original high skirtings. Neutral decor and carpeted floor. BEDROOM TWO 2.55m(8'4'') x 3.42m(11'3'') With double glazed window overlooking the rear of the property, newly fitted built-in wardrobe and floating shelving. Carpeted floor and neutral decor. BEDROOM THREE 2.12m(6'11'') x 3.56m(11'8'') With double glazed window overlooking the rear of the property. Carpeted floor and neutral decor. (plans in place for the addition of a w.c., and washbasin) OUTSIDE The front garden is paved for low maintenance with streetlined parking. The rear has a remote controlled electric gate onto driveway providing off road parking for one car, also single gate on to gated alleyway. The walled rear garden, which is south facing gets the afternoon and evening sunshine is also paved with well established borders of shrubs, hedges and seasonal planting.
